What makes the Royal Clipper in Palma different from a regular cruise ship?
It looks like a classic sailing ship but operates as a modern cruise yacht.
Can you see the Royal Clipper from the Passeig Marítim in Palma?
Yes, the Passeig Marítim is one of the easiest places to spot it.
What is the best time of day to photograph the Royal Clipper in Palma?
Morning is usually best for details; afternoon works well for silhouettes.
How long does the Royal Clipper usually stay in Palma?
It often stays only for a few hours, so port notices are worth checking.
Is the Royal Clipper a good fit for Mallorca compared with larger cruise ships?
It feels smaller, quieter and more personal than a large cruise ship.
What should I bring if I want to watch the Royal Clipper in Palma?
Bring comfortable shoes, a camera and enough time to enjoy the view.
What kind of experience does the Royal Clipper offer on board?
It offers a calmer sailing experience with modern comfort and a traditional feel.
